• About Us
  • Disclaimer
  • Contact Us
  • Privacy Policy
Thursday, July 17, 2025
mGrowTech
No Result
View All Result
  • Technology And Software
    • Account Based Marketing
    • Channel Marketing
    • Marketing Automation
      • Al, Analytics and Automation
      • Ad Management
  • Digital Marketing
    • Social Media Management
    • Google Marketing
  • Direct Marketing
    • Brand Management
    • Marketing Attribution and Consulting
  • Mobile Marketing
  • Event Management
  • PR Solutions
  • Technology And Software
    • Account Based Marketing
    • Channel Marketing
    • Marketing Automation
      • Al, Analytics and Automation
      • Ad Management
  • Digital Marketing
    • Social Media Management
    • Google Marketing
  • Direct Marketing
    • Brand Management
    • Marketing Attribution and Consulting
  • Mobile Marketing
  • Event Management
  • PR Solutions
No Result
View All Result
mGrowTech
No Result
View All Result
Home Al, Analytics and Automation

New Blog series – Memoirs of a TorchVision developer

Josh by Josh
June 1, 2025
in Al, Analytics and Automation
0
New Blog series – Memoirs of a TorchVision developer
0
SHARES
0
VIEWS
Share on FacebookShare on Twitter

READ ALSO

Getting Started with Mirascope: Removing Semantic Duplicates using an LLM

Your First OpenAI API Project in Python Step-By-Step


  • August 21, 2021
  • Vasilis Vryniotis
  • . No comments

I’m starting a new blog post series about the development of PyTorch’s computer vision library. I plan to discuss interesting upcoming features primarily from TorchVision and secondary from the PyTorch ecosystem. My target is to highlight new and in-development features and provide clarity of what’s happening in between the releases. Though the format is likely to change over time, I initially plan to keep it bite-sized and offer references for those who want to dig deeper. Finally, instead of publishing articles on fixed intervals, I’ll be posting when I have enough interesting topics to cover.

Disclaimer: The features covered will be biased towards topics I’m personally interested. The PyTorch ecosystem is massive and I only have visibility over a tiny part of it. Covering (or not covering) a feature says nothing about its importance. Opinions expressed are solely my own.

With that out of the way, let’s see what’s cooking:

Label Smoothing for CrossEntropy Loss

A highly requested feature on PyTorch is to support soft targets and add a label smoothing option in Cross Entropy loss. Both features target in making it easy to do Label Smoothing, with the first option offering more flexibility when Data Augmentation techniques such as mixup/cutmix are used and the second being more performant for the simple cases. The soft targets option has already been merged on master by Joel Schlosser while the label_smoothing option is being developed by Thomas J. Fan and is currently under review.

New Warm-up Scheduler

Learning Rate warm up is a common technique used when training models but until now PyTorch didn’t offer an off-the-shelf solution. Recently, Ilqar Ramazanli has introduced a new Scheduler supporting linear and constant warmup. Currently in progress is the work around improving the chain-ability and combination of existing schedulers.

TorchVision with “Batteries included”

This half we are working on adding in TorchVision popular Models, Losses, Schedulers, Data Augmentations and other utilities used to achieve state-of-the-art results. This project is aptly named “Batteries included” and is currently in progress.

Earlier this week, I’ve added a new layer called StochasticDepth which can be used to randomly drop residual branches in residual architectures. Currently I’m working on adding an implementation of the popular network architecture called EfficientNet. Finally, Allen Goodman is currently adding a new operator that will enable converting Segmentation Masks to Bounding Boxes.

Other features in-development

Thought we constantly make incremental improvements on the documentation, CI infrastructure and overall code quality, below I highlight some of the “user-facing” roadmap items which are in-development:

That’s it! I hope you found it interesting. Any ideas on how to adapt the format or what topics to cover are very welcome. Hit me up on LinkedIn or Twitter.





Source_link

Related Posts

Getting Started with Mirascope: Removing Semantic Duplicates using an LLM
Al, Analytics and Automation

Getting Started with Mirascope: Removing Semantic Duplicates using an LLM

July 17, 2025
Your First OpenAI API Project in Python Step-By-Step
Al, Analytics and Automation

Your First OpenAI API Project in Python Step-By-Step

July 17, 2025
How to more efficiently study complex treatment interactions | MIT News
Al, Analytics and Automation

How to more efficiently study complex treatment interactions | MIT News

July 16, 2025
NVIDIA Just Released Audio Flamingo 3: An Open-Source Model Advancing Audio General Intelligence
Al, Analytics and Automation

NVIDIA Just Released Audio Flamingo 3: An Open-Source Model Advancing Audio General Intelligence

July 16, 2025
10 NumPy One-Liners to Simplify Feature Engineering
Al, Analytics and Automation

10 NumPy One-Liners to Simplify Feature Engineering

July 16, 2025
Amazon Releases Kiro: An AI IDE That Empowers Developers with Agentic Automation
Al, Analytics and Automation

Amazon Releases Kiro: An AI IDE That Empowers Developers with Agentic Automation

July 15, 2025
Next Post
Advertising in sensitive and regulated industries: tips and tricks

Advertising in sensitive and regulated industries: tips and tricks

POPULAR NEWS

Communication Effectiveness Skills For Business Leaders

Communication Effectiveness Skills For Business Leaders

June 10, 2025
7 Best EOR Platforms for Software Companies in 2025

7 Best EOR Platforms for Software Companies in 2025

June 21, 2025
Eating Bugs – MetaDevo

Eating Bugs – MetaDevo

May 29, 2025
Top B2B & Marketing Podcasts to Lead You to Succeed in 2025 – TopRank® Marketing

Top B2B & Marketing Podcasts to Lead You to Succeed in 2025 – TopRank® Marketing

May 30, 2025
Discover 10 Ways Wearable Chatbots Are Changing Health, Productivity & Communication

Discover 10 Ways Wearable Chatbots Are Changing Health, Productivity & Communication

June 24, 2025

EDITOR'S PICK

Facebook Notifications Placement – Jon Loomer Digital

Facebook Notifications Placement – Jon Loomer Digital

June 25, 2025

The Scoop: McDonald’s reassures DEI policies still central to organization amid nationwide boycott

June 26, 2025

Why ‘authenticity’ is such a tough buzzword to replace 

June 23, 2025
Frequency vs dwell time –

Frequency vs dwell time –

June 3, 2025

About

We bring you the best Premium WordPress Themes that perfect for news, magazine, personal blog, etc. Check our landing page for details.

Follow us

Categories

  • Account Based Marketing
  • Ad Management
  • Al, Analytics and Automation
  • Brand Management
  • Channel Marketing
  • Digital Marketing
  • Direct Marketing
  • Event Management
  • Google Marketing
  • Marketing Attribution and Consulting
  • Marketing Automation
  • Mobile Marketing
  • PR Solutions
  • Social Media Management
  • Technology And Software
  • Uncategorized

Recent Posts

  • The Scoop: Jamie Dimon opposes Trump on federal reserve independence without saying his name
  • How the LinkedIn algorithm works in 2025
  • The FCC plans to ban Chinese technology in undersea cables
  • Getting Started with Mirascope: Removing Semantic Duplicates using an LLM
  • About Us
  • Disclaimer
  • Contact Us
  • Privacy Policy
No Result
View All Result
  • Technology And Software
    • Account Based Marketing
    • Channel Marketing
    • Marketing Automation
      • Al, Analytics and Automation
      • Ad Management
  • Digital Marketing
    • Social Media Management
    • Google Marketing
  • Direct Marketing
    • Brand Management
    • Marketing Attribution and Consulting
  • Mobile Marketing
  • Event Management
  • PR Solutions

Are you sure want to unlock this post?
Unlock left : 0
Are you sure want to cancel subscription?